In order to control vibrations of machinery, it is very important to grasp the dynamics characteristic of the systems. Modal analysis is widely used as a basic technology for machine design. Various methods to identify the modal parameters of structures by the vibration test are proposed. Recently, the time domain subspace method has been researched actively. However, it is difficult to overview dynamic properties of structures from time domain data. In this paper, the frequency domain subspace algorithm is employed to identify modal parameters. Two kinds of algorithms are compared in numerical examples. Finally, the identification procedure is applied to a steel plate.
